Episode 211
LISTENER Q&A: This week we had a listener email from Paul in Canada and a listener question from Lindsey in North Carolina:- Paul just recently retired at the ripe age of 48, and after listening to Side Hustle School every morning during his stretches he's decided to launch a side hustle with all of his newly acquired free time. He has a lot of ideas, and I can't wait to feature him one day on the show!
- Lindsey and her husband have been considering starting up a business importing products from North Africa, but after hours of research, they can't seem to find a method of shipping that would not be cost prohibitive for them. She called in to ask if I have any recommendations for them regarding shipping partners that will not cost them an arm and a leg to get their products to the U.S.
